Output 7b62cd233b27d9377d3391baa8e5a098e9dec2bc61a949c798d63ea78a9a6414:0

value
342052310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d360eacef18d2d35b807169495936a8018b6ec0 OP_EQUAL
address
3JwUPmXkXqvyLkbyfJMuseZRNLxEJEBsFh
transaction
7b62cd233b27d9377d3391baa8e5a098e9dec2bc61a949c798d63ea78a9a6414
spent
true